Output 40709d66c2a8723d1c4815b71c944ee8d4d5aec8c495431909575ec118fa48e7:0

value
666311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81a4533a982299f0499002d87341e676e14ccd0 OP_EQUAL
address
3NrGALoTZ45dEi4g45GL51JQMqzHVpjXsf
transaction
40709d66c2a8723d1c4815b71c944ee8d4d5aec8c495431909575ec118fa48e7
spent
true